What is a salaried pool cleaner?

Salaried pool cleaners are professionals who are employed by companies, facilities, or private clients to maintain and clean swimming pools on a regular basis and receive a fixed salary rather than being paid per job. Their responsibilities typically include checking water quality, adding chemicals, cleaning filters, vacuuming pool floors, and ensuring pool equipment is functioning properly. Unlike freelance or hourly pool cleaners, salaried pool cleaners often have set schedules and additional benefits such as health insurance or paid time off. This job requires attention to detail, physical stamina, and knowledge of pool maintenance techniques.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a salaried pool cleaner?

To thrive as a Salaried Pool Cleaner, you need knowledge of pool maintenance, water chemistry, and basic mechanical skills, often supported by a high school diploma and on-the-job training. Familiarity with pool cleaning equipment, chemical testing kits, and sometimes certification in pool operation or safety is typically required. Attention to detail, reliability, and strong communication with clients are valuable soft skills in this role. These abilities ensure pools are safe, clean, and well-maintained, leading to satisfied customers and efficient service.

What are some common challenges salaried pool cleaners face, and how can they effectively manage them?

Salaried pool cleaners often encounter challenges such as managing multiple service appointments in a day, troubleshooting unexpected equipment issues, and working outdoors in varying weather conditions. Staying organized with a well-planned route and maintaining regular communication with clients can help streamline the workload. Building familiarity with pool systems and proactively performing routine maintenance minimizes emergency repairs, making the job more manageable and efficient.

What is the difference between Salaried Pool Cleaner vs Hourly Pool Cleaner?

AspectSalaried Pool CleanerHourly Pool Cleaner
Pay StructureFixed salary regardless of hours workedPaid based on hours worked
Work ScheduleTypically regular hours, predictable scheduleVariable hours, often seasonal or as needed
CredentialsUsually requires basic pool maintenance certificationSame as salaried, may require certification
Work EnvironmentConsistent, on-site pool maintenanceSimilar environment, may include more flexible hours

The main difference between a Salaried Pool Cleaner and an Hourly Pool Cleaner lies in their pay structure and scheduling. Salaried workers receive a fixed salary and often have a predictable schedule, while hourly workers are paid based on hours worked and may have more variable hours. Both roles typically require similar certifications and work in comparable environments.

Job description

Title: Pool Technician

Schedule: Monday-Friday 7am-5pm (some weekends as needed)

Job Type: Full-Time

Pay Range: $20-27 (depending on experience)

Job Summary

Our company is looking for a reliable Pool Service Technician to join our team. In this role, you will start up & close pools, troubleshoot pool equipment, including but not limited to: automatic covers, pumps, leaks, and electrical issues. You will also measure and reinstall covers and vinyl liners, break out concrete, trowel pool base, use vacuums/nets to help clean debris from various pools, change & clean filters, and troubleshoot all other types of pool equipment. You must have a valid driver's license to drive to client homes. Experience with pumps, heaters, and auto covers is a must. Our ideal candidate is someone with prior pool management or maintenance experience, but we are willing to provide some training if you are a good fit for the job. We expect all of our employees to have a clean and professional demeanor, and a strong customer service skill set.

Job Duties

  • Building pools from the ground up - physical labor , running equipment
  • Startup and shutdown pools for the season
  • Perform routine maintenance and repairs on swimming pools and related equipment 
  • Clean and maintain pool filters, pumps, and chemical feeders 
  • Test water chemistry and adjust chemical levels as needed 
  • Vacuum and skim pool surfaces to remove debris 
  • Repair or replace pool equipment such as motors, heaters, and valves 
  • Troubleshoot and diagnose issues with pool systems 
  • Maintain accurate records of work performed 
  • Repair/reinstall all parts of automatic covers 
  • Install replacement vinyl liners
  • Other duties as assigned

Essential Requirements 

  • 2-5 years of experience with pools, landscaping, and physical outdoor work is required
  • Knowledge of hand tools and power tools used in pool maintenance and repair
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to follow instructions
  • Excellent problem-solving skills 
  • Valid driver's license is required
  • Ability to work independently and prioritize tasks effectively
  • Good communication skills to interact with clients and provide excellent customer service
